Yaren District (INU) to Tokyo (NRT) Flight Distance

The flight distance from Nauru International Airport (INU) in Yaren District, Nauru to Narita International Airport (NRT) in Tokyo, Japan is 4,883 kilometers (3,034 miles / 2,637 nautical miles). The estimated flight time for this route is approximately 7h, flying north northwest at a heading of 328°.
